AP EAMCET Application Form: Procedure
Registration: Mar ' 26 - Apr ' 26
The following are the steps to fill out the AP EAMCET application form online for Andhra Pradesh state and make the fee payment. These simple steps will help candidates to fill out the application form with ease.
Step-1: Application fee payment
- Candidates need to visit the official website of AP EAMCET
- Click on the ‘Apply Online' link available on the website homepage
- As soon as the candidate clicks on the above-mentioned link, a web page with the registration fee payment procedure will appear on the computer screen
- There are two modes of making registration fee payments along with their respective procedures. The two modes of payment are Online or through debit or credit card. Candidates can choose the mode of payment that they find appropriate.
On selecting registration fee payment via AP online, the following steps have to be followed:
- Opt for the nearest AP Online centre
- Visit the above centre along with important details such as qualifying examination passed, hall ticket number of the qualifying examination i.e. Intermediate, 10+2 or equivalent and details such as the name of the candidate, father’s name, date of birth, contact number, email ID, stream applying for, etc.
- Fill out the form at the AP online centre and pay the requisite fee. Thereafter, you will receive a receipt form for the registration amount paid. The receipt contains the transaction ID.
- Next, visit the official website of AP EAMCET 2025 and log in using the transaction ID you have been provided with
- Click on the “Application Form’ button
- Thereafter, fill all the fields of the online application form with the required details
- Then verify all the details carefully and click on the 'Submit' button
- Next, the filled-in application form is generated which contains a unique registration no., as well as application details
- Save the filled-in application form and take a printout
On selecting registration fee payment via debit/credit card, the following steps have to be followed:
- Click on the “Pay online using your Debit/Credit Card” button to navigate to the “Payment Gateway”.
- Fill in the details in the fields that follow
- As soon as the payment is made successfully, you will be given a transaction ID for all future correspondence
- Click on the “Application Form’ button and fill in all the fields of the online application form with the required details
- Verify all the details carefully and click on the 'Submit' button
- The filled-in application form will be generated containing a unique registration number as well as application details
- Save this filled-in application form and take a print. This form needs to be submitted in the exam hall
- Note down the registration number and keep it for all future correspondence
Note: Candidates applying for AP EAMCET 2025 first need to pay the application fee. Filling the application form is the second step.
AP EAMCET application form 2025 fees
Category | Application Fee |
---|---|
General |
INR 600 |
SC/ST |
INR 500 |
BC |
INR 550 |
Step-2: Filling of AP EAMCET Application Form 2025
Below are the documents required to fill AP EAMCET application form 2025:
-
Class 12 hall ticket number/roll number
-
Class 10 or equivalent hall ticket number
-
Proof of date of birth (DOB certificate)
-
Caste certificate in case of SC/ST/BC candidates
-
Aadhaar number
-
Certificate for PH, NCC, sports category etc.
-
Income certificate (up to INR 1 lakh / up to INR 2 lakhs / more than INR 2 lakhs)
-
Ration card
-
Study or Residence or relevant certificate for proof of local status (for the past 12 years)
Candidates will have to fill in fields marked with an asterisk in the application form for AP EAMCET 2025. The following details will have to be entered by the candidates:
Details of candidates:
- Name and date of birth
- Gender, category, birth state & district
- Father’s & mother’s name
- The annual income of parents
- Aadhaar card number
- Minority/non-minority
Communication address:
- House number
- Village/locality
- District
- State, etc.
Qualifying examination details:
- Type of Exam – Intermediate (Regular)
- Intermediate (Vocational)
- RGUKT (IV) CBSE
- ICSE
- DIPLOMA, The National Institute of Open Schooling (NIOS), TS Open School Society (TSOSS), Andhra Pradesh Open School Society (APOSS)
Common entrance test details:
Stream/entrance exam: The details entered by the candidate during registration will be frozen as follows:
- Engineering (E)
- Agriculture & Medical (AM)
- Both (Engineering and Agriculture & Medical) (E & AM)
Select the language for AP EAMCET 2025: Select any one language from the available options - English, Telugu, and Urdu.
Step 3: Uploading scanned images of the photograph and signature
Upload your photograph and signature in the prescribed format. If a candidate has already appeared/ passed intermediate (regular), their photographs and signatures will automatically be populated from the already existing intermediate base and will consequently be frozen.
Specifications of photograph and signature
Item |
Photo Size |
Format |
---|---|---|
Signature |
Less than 15 KB |
JPG |
Photograph |
Less than 30 KB |
JPG |
Test centre preference: The candidate will have to select any two districts in order of preference.
Step 4: Taking a printout of completed application form
Once the application form for AP EAMCET 2025 is submitted, the completed form will be displayed on the screen. Candidates must take two to three printouts of the completed application form 2025 for future reference. This is what the AP EAMCET confirmation page looks like:

How to check AP EAPCET (EAMCET) Application Form 2026 Status?
The conducting authority will provide candidates with an option to track the progress of the AP EAMCET application form on the official website. The tracking system will be updated after 72 hours of completion of the application process. An option 'Track Application Status' will appear on the screen. Candidates have to enter their application number, password and security code to know the progress of the application form submitted online.

AP EAMCET 2026 Application Form: Correction Window
JNTU Kakinada opens the AP EAMCET correction window to edit/modify details in the application form. Candidates who fill in the applications could make the corrections (if required) in online mode only. The application form correction facility will be available only to those candidates who have completed all the steps of the application.
Also Read: AP EAMCET Application Form Correction 2025 Dates, Details to Edit, Steps to Edit Application Form
How to make corrections to the AP EAMCET 2026 Application Form?
- Open the AP EAMCET 2026 application form correction link
- Only registered candidates who submit their forms can use the link to make modifications
- Enter login details like AP EAMCET registration number, payment reference ID, qualifying examination hall ticket number, mobile number, and date of birth
- After entering all the required details, click on the 'Submit' button
- AP EAMCET application form will open, and you can correct mistakes in the filled-in application form
Details you can edit using the AP EAMCET 2026 correction window
- The medium of instruction in the qualifying examination
- Qualifying exam - the year of appearing/passing
- Non-minority/minority
- The medium of instruction in the qualifying exam
- The annual income of the parents
- Place of study intermediate or equivalent
- Academic details
- Bridge course hall ticket number
- Mother’s name
- SSC Hall ticket number & year of passing
- Birth State
- District
- Exam 10+2 studies in gender
- Place of study- SSC or equivalent
- Community
- Special category
- Address for correspondence
- Aadhaar card number
- Mobile/ email-ID
Details you can edit by visiting Convener /AP EAMCET 2026 Office
- Name of candidate
- SSC mark list
- Father’s name
- Date of birth (SSC or equivalent)
- Signature
- Scanned signature
- Scanned photograph
Qualifying hall ticket number
